Date: 26 Jul 2025Company: Air Arabia PJSC (G9)Location: Sharjah, AECountry: AEJob PurposeAssists the Engineer to perform Airframe and Engine Maintenance tasks on Air Arabia and Third party aircrafts including inspections, repairs and component replacement, performs and records work up to required standards and in accordance with Air Arabia and regulatory requirements. Key Result ResponsibilitiesReviews assigned task cards with the Engineer-in-Charge to gain full understanding of the work, priorities, documentation requirements and cautions, prior to starting work.

Prepares and performs scheduled aircraft maintenance according to assigned task cards, ensuring that the required documentation, parts, tools and GSE are obtained and used per issued instructions. Carries out aircraft test and inspection tasks to the standard necessary to fully identify and record any defects or damage in accordance with approved maintenance procedures. Carries out repairs, component replacements and tests as instructed by assigned task cards fully in accordance with approved data and procedures and as directed by the Engineer-in-Charge.

Ensures proper tooling / equipment is drawn from stores to perform tasks, returning all of it in good condition following completion of work. Regularly reports the status of assigned tasks to the Engineer-in-Charge and alerts him or her to any problems with aircraft condition or with the execution of the work. Demonstrates high level of consideration to housekeeping standards in all tasks performed. Manages the safety of own assigned maintenance tasks, ensuring all published mandatory precautions are taken prior to commencing work and during task execution.

Takes positive steps to protect self and other persons in the area of the maintenance activity from any possible injury, including the use of proper GSE and protective equipment. Pays attention to human factors aspects of maintenance, ensuring that work interruption procedures are followed and that adequate access and lighting is used for maintenance and inspections. Internal Customer Service: provides helpful information and support to own team and to other department personnel involved with managing scheduled maintenance checksRepresenting Air Arabia: presents a positive and competent image of technical professionalism to other companies’ personnel and ABY customers.

Maintains positive awareness to the cost of aircraft maintenance including use of time and materials. Minimises unnecessary waste of consumable material and part repair cost by avoiding unnecessary damage and repeat work during maintenance. Qualifications (Academic, Training, Languages)Qualified and experienced Civil Aircraft Maintenance Technician. Ability to read, write, speak and understand English to a good standard for technical communications. Ability to use computer (Microsoft Office). Ability to obtain UAE Driver’s License. Work ExperienceExternal applicantsAt least 2 years’ experience performing maintenance on large commercial aircraft, preferably Airbus types. At least 2 years’ experience in Base Maintenance environment.

Able to demonstrate solid basic understanding of Airframe and Engine Maintenance theory and practice.
